7th International Summer School Spectroelectrochemistry

The summer school provides theoretical and practical training in state-of-the-art methods in the field.

From 29 August to 4 September 2025, the 7th International Summer School Spectroelectrochemistry will take place at the Leibniz Institute for Solid State and Materials Research Dresden (IFW Dresden).

This one-week event offers a comprehensive program combining theoretical foundations and hands-on training in state-of-the-art spectroelectrochemical techniques – including in situ ESR/EPR, NMR, UV-vis-NIR, luminescence, FTIR and Raman spectroelectrochemistry, as well as computational modelling. Renowned scientists will deliver lectures and guide small-group laboratory sessions.

Participants will also have the opportunity to present their own research in a poster session, with awards for the best contributions. The event will be held in English.

The International Summer School Spectroelectrochemistry is a well-established and highly regarded event within the scientific community, regularly hosted at IFW Dresden.
